2. 导致parcel data not fully consumed, unread size错误的可能原因 数据写入与读取不匹配:writeToParcel中写入的数据类型和顺序与createFromParcel中读取的不一致。 数据未完全读取:在createFromParcel方法中,没有按照writeToParcel的顺序完全读取所有数据。 额外的数据被写入:在writeToParcel中可能不小心写入了额外的数据,...
Has at or near beginning place where we can put arbitrary data (e.g.ints orStrings that are just data and don't affect serialization process) Can containRemoteViews(either directly or via arbitraryreadParcelable) Has not too long fully qualified class name, because we're still size limited ...
Because not everyone needs it, compression is opt-in. Just add@parcel/compressor-gzipand/or@parcel/compressor-brotlito your.parcelrc. Then, you'll get.gzand.brfiles along with your original bundles. Seethe docsfor more details on how to set this up. Compression is not limited to Gzip and...
Has at or near beginning place where we can put arbitrary data (e.g.ints orStrings that are just data and don't affect serialization process) Can containRemoteViews(either directly or via arbitraryreadParcelable) Has not too long fully qualified class name, because we're still size limited ...
Indeed, the instances in the literature do not come from real or realistic settings, but they are usually based on the generalisation of classical instances or artificial data often not generated for urban applications, making difficult the assessment of new models. The reason of such unavailability...